Quality Inspector Job Responsibilities:
- Inspects in-process production by confirming specifications, conducting visual and measurement tests, communicating required adjustments to production personnel.
- Approves finished products by confirming specifications, conducting visual and measurement tests, returning products for re-work, and confirming re-work.
- Documents inspection results by completing reports, summarizes re-work and inputs data into quality database.
- Keeps measurement equipment operating by following operating instructions and calibration requirements, and calling for repairs.
- Maintains safe and healthy work environment by following standards and procedures, and complying with legal regulations.
- Updates job knowledge by participating in educational opportunities and reading technical publications.
- Accomplishes quality and organization mission by completing related results as needed
